The red wine Cahors AOC Château de Chambert Grand Vin, vintage 2009 from the winery Château de Chambert has been rated in 2011 with 93 Falstaff points. It is a wine made from the grape variety Malbec from the region South West France in France.

Tasting Notes

93
Tasting from 14.10.2011

Deep dark ruby colour, opaque core, purple reflections, delicate edge brightening. Delicately floral black cherry fruit on the nose, delicately savoury, hints of orange zest, some nougat. Full-bodied and fresh, elegant extract sweetness, fine tannins, balanced, still young, will benefit from further bottle ageing, sweet finish, shows great length, very promising, black berries on the finish, sure development and certain ageing potential.
